I would love to see other Superboat owners do the crossing also.

Dangit if they could do it in a 21 foot bay boat how about the rest of the SB clan. I say part of the 40th celebration is to have 5 SB owners cross the Atlantic. And it's safer in bigger numbers.

When I was planning to do this, redundancy were in my thoughts: double radios, doubel GPS, double engines.

Take Sean's 30CC for instance. He's half way to getting his boat built not just for speed but also for effeciency in making the crossing. He's got double engines already. Another radio would not cost too much. One nice GPS chartplotter is all he would need.

Now you may ask about the fuel...well he's got plenty of space for a fuel bladder cell. Just look at all the space he's got upfront and the good thing is, when he's done, just remove the fuel cell. Look at the attached pic and tell me he if he doesn't have enough space for fuel?

if a 21 foot bay boat can do it, so can a 30CC with twin 250's !

When Sean gets to Europe lay it up for the winter, then the following year fly back to the 30CC and continue the voyage!

Some updates on the 34. Steve has completed the install of the steering system, controls, instruments, battery switches, and automatic battery charging loaders.



Here are the instruments. The strengths of the SC gauges come into play during the night. On those long overnite passage runs, when one man is running the 34 and the other is snoozing, you want gauges that can be read accurately at a glance.
